Quoted from judremy:

Found a MAJOR bug last night that I will be adding to the bugs thread. I was in Magneto multiball and a light came loose (good ole 555s under slings). Luckily, I have door ball saver turned on. I feet the bulb back in and close it all back up. Four new balls shoot out. Right after that, Magneto multiball ends. I am now playing the regular game with FOUR balls on the playfield. I then drain one and the ball ends, but not before loading two new balls in the shooter lane. I then start the next ball with two balls and after one drains, it is ball over. I don't think the code is setup to handle this right because the original multiball should have never ended when it did.

Could that be related to the problem some of us had with the wireform switch in front of the ball holder for magneto multiball? I found the end of mine hanging up against the plastic "frame" for it below the playfield and had to trim it slightly. Some other guys rebent that wire the ball rolls over a little bit to prevent the end from hanging up on the plastic. The symptoms sound familiar even though only doing it occasionally. If it has been hanging up you will find scratches in the plastic to prove it, and then you will know thats the problem.
